Yes but that ruins the look of my engine bay! Anyway... the wires came today. I'll wait until the red shields come before installing them but they definitely are nice wires, and huge conductors. Here's comparisons between AC Delco OEM's, MSD Superconductors, and the Taylor 10.4 mm Race wires. Small to big. I also like how the Taylors have a place to grip the boot at the plug so you don't have to fight removing them.
